Output 87eab9f26c23e47408d727f20abc48528990f6efd3af291b1d09bf7bf9980420:0

value
24376707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ae17bf8eb4c0d2fd8637b8a39c15f93cf7a6afd2 OP_EQUAL
address
3HZXwyrYgGniVyky6ZGhVgufdLYK8wAp2a
transaction
87eab9f26c23e47408d727f20abc48528990f6efd3af291b1d09bf7bf9980420
spent
true